WhatsUp Gold and Azure Bastion compete in network management. Azure Bastion often has the upper hand due to its secure integration with Azure services, appealing to Azure-centric environments.
Features: WhatsUp Gold offers real-time network monitoring, extensive dashboard customization, and detailed reporting capabilities. Azure Bastion provides seamless integration with Azure services, secure remote access, and emphasizes security without exposing resources to the internet.
Room for Improvement: WhatsUp Gold could enhance its cloud compatibility and improve its user interface for novice users, and more flexible pricing options would be beneficial. Azure Bastion can expand its integration capabilities outside Azure, improve performance in non-Azure environments, and offer more detailed documentation for complex configurations.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: WhatsUp Gold, deployed on-premises, offers flexibility in configuration and notable customer service. Azure Bastion, as a cloud-native product, streamlines setup for Azure users but requires sufficient resources and leverages Microsoft's support network for customer service.
Pricing and ROI: WhatsUp Gold's costs vary by deployment scale and features, with ROI through system uptime prevention. Azure Bastion, under Azure subscription, integrates costs within Azure services, providing potential ROI benefits for established Azure users.
Azure Bastion is a service you deploy that lets you connect to a virtual machine using your browser and the Azure portal. The Azure Bastion service is a fully platform-managed PaaS service that you provision inside your virtual network. It provides secure and seamless RDP/SSH connectivity to your virtual machines directly from the Azure portal over TLS. When you connect via Azure Bastion, your virtual machines do not need a public IP address, agent, or special client software.
